## Shuttle-Bus Gate — Night Access

The shuttle-bus gate at the Marwick Campus perimeter locks automatically at 22:00. Night-shift staff meeting the last Ferncrest shuttle must open it manually from the keypad pillar on the inbound side. Check the gate re-latches fully after each use. Enter the gate code listed below.

badge for fawep-bahop: bdg-EWZVI-26220

## Changelog — GalleryWhisper v4.2

Hey, welcome aboard! Quick heads-up on defaults we changed this sprint. The audio-guide app now auto-pauses narration when a visitor walks out of beacon range (used to keep playing into the void, which was weird). We also bumped the default download quality to 96 kbps and turned offline caching on by default for the Hartwell Museum pilot. Nothing breaks, but cached bundles get bigger. The new defaults the app ships with are listed below.

config for kafof-bawef:
holath:
  log_level: debug
  metrics_host: metrics.holath.qorvelsys.internal
  pin: 2191
  pool_size: 32

## Step 4: Wire up role-based access

Before your plugin can read or edit pages on a Quillwick wiki, it needs to authenticate against the roles service. Editors, reviewers, and admins each map to a scope your plugin requests at startup. Don't hardcode scopes — pull them from config. Add the following line to your plugin's env file:

vault entry, yahif-yajep: COURIER_KEY29=b802bdf8034096b65a51c6ba5abe2